Complete Buying Guide for Portable Air Compressor For Truck Tires
Essential Factors We Consider
When selecting the best portable air compressor for truck tires, several critical factors come into play. First, pressure output must meet or exceed your tire requirements—most truck tires need at least 100–150 PSI. Next, consider airflow (CFM), which determines how fast you can inflate larger tires. Portability matters too; look for lightweight designs with comfortable handles or carrying cases. Battery-powered models offer greater freedom, but corded ones may deliver more sustained power. Finally, check compatibility with your vehicle’s tire size and whether the unit includes useful extras like gauges, nozzles, and auto shut-off.
Budget Planning
Portable air compressors for truck tires range from affordable $50 models to premium $300+ units. Entry-level compressors are fine for light-duty use or small trucks, but heavy-duty applications require higher-end models with stronger motors and better cooling systems. Remember to factor in accessories—some kits include hoses, nozzles, and bags, saving you money later. While it’s tempting to choose the cheapest option, investing in a reliable compressor pays off in longevity and performance, especially if you drive frequently or tow heavy loads.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Can I use a regular car tire inflator for truck tires?
A: Not always. Regular car inflators often lack sufficient pressure (PSI) and airflow (CFM) for larger truck tires. Using them risks incomplete inflation and potential damage. Always verify your compressor meets the minimum requirements for your truck’s tire size and recommended pressure.
Q: How long does it take to inflate a truck tire with a portable compressor?
A: It depends on the compressor’s CFM rating and the tire’s size and starting pressure. Most heavy-duty models can inflate a standard truck tire (e.g., 31” x 10.5R15) from empty to full (35 PSI) in 3–6 minutes. Smaller cordless models may take longer.
Q: Do portable air compressors work in cold weather?

Q: Are cordless or corded compressors better for truck use?
A: It depends on your needs. Cordless models offer unmatched convenience and mobility, ideal for remote locations. Corded compressors draw power directly from your truck’s battery (with engine running), providing consistent power for longer durations. For frequent or heavy use, many prefer corded for reliability.
Q: What’s the difference between PSI and CFM in air compressors?
A: PSI (pounds per square inch) measures pressure—how much force the compressor can generate. CFM (cubic feet per minute) measures airflow—how much air volume it moves. Both matter: high PSI ensures deep inflation, while high CFM speeds up the process, especially for large tires.
